WebEstrogen-only therapy is taken daily. There are two ways to combine estrogen and progestin for women who still have a uterus: Continuous-combined therapy: Both estrogen and progestin are taken every day. Cyclic therapy: Estrogen is taken daily. Progestin is added for 10 to 14 days each month (usually as a pill). Web1 nov. 2024 · An analysis of more than 800,000 women in Denmark offers more insight into the murky links between female hormones and midlife mental illness in women: It hints that hormone therapy (HT) may boost the risk of depression, have no effect, or lower it – all depending on how it’s administered and when.
